The fresh new LLPA Laws

fast payday installment loans

The latest Biden Administration promulgated the borrowed funds Top Rate Changes (LLPA) rule in the , by way of Freddie Mac and you can Fannie mae. By the surgery of these companies, the newest signal will come towards effect on , barring congressional step who take off it.

Simply said, the brand new LLPA signal do subsidize riskier borrowers of the levying additional charges towards the alot more prudent and less risky borrowers.

The fresh rule manage end in straight down monthly home loan repayments to possess riskier buyers, those with fico scores below 680, and the ones having quicker downpayments. To buy this type of subsidies, the latest Biden Management carry out enforce charges on homebuyers that have a good credit ratings and you will huge downpayments.

The Federal Homes Funds Agency (FHFA), which is accountable for implementing the code, keeps assured far more punitive redistributions when you look at the .
